Google's AI platform, Gemini, has officially reached the one-billion-user milestone, joining an elite group of Google products. CEO Sundar Pichai announced the achievement on X, noting that Gemini is now the fastest-growing product in the company's history. While a significant feat for Google, Gemini follows OpenAI's ChatGPT in reaching this massive scale. This milestone marks a turning point in the mainstream adoption of generative AI, as two of the world's leading platforms now command audiences comparable to established digital services. The rapid growth of these tools highlights the accelerating pace of AI integration into daily life and the competitive landscape between tech giants.

OpenAI Special Projects Lead Brad Lightcap Announces Departure After Eight-Year Tenure to Pursue New Venture

Brad Lightcap, a prominent executive at OpenAI, has officially announced his departure from the artificial intelligence research lab after an eight-year tenure. Having previously served as the company's Chief Operating Officer (COO) before transitioning to his most recent role as the special projects lead, Lightcap's exit marks the conclusion of a significant chapter in his career. In an internal memo later shared on the social media platform X, Lightcap informed his colleagues that he has spent the past several months contemplating the "next horizon" and intends to start "something new." This leadership transition comes as Lightcap moves on from his long-standing position at the forefront of the AI industry to explore independent opportunities.
